Office Support Specialist (Access Point) - Engineering Administration

Undergraduate Programs Office

Job Summary
Deliver clerical and administrative duties for the Access Point Office.

Duties & Responsibilities

Front Desk/Reception

  • Serve as first point of contact for all visitors to the Access Point units.
  • Screen calls and emails including routine inquiries, requests, or problems for all Access Point units.
  • Assist students and other visitors in checking in for Access Point services such as appointments, interviews, and events in the Access Point office suites.
  • Open Access Point shared spaces to the team and public including turning on lights, opening entrances and turning on shared equipment when the office opens.
  • Close Access Point shared spaces to the team and public including turning off lights, closing entrances and turning off shared equipment when the office closes.
Space/Supplies Coordination
  • Coordinate with Facilities & Services and other vendors/service providers to resolve maintenance problems.
  • Maintain office supply and equipment inventory.
  • Manage internal and external space reservations.
  • Be responsible and accountable for all room keys and iCard access to suites 3270 DCL (Digital Computer Lab) and 3300 DCL, including a log of all staff members issued keys and iCard permissions.
  • Pick up, sort, and distribute postal mail for the office • Receive and ship boxes and materials via UPS and other providers.
  • Serve as floor coordinator for BEAP (Building Emergency Action Plan), turning off shared equipment when the office closes.
P-Card/T-Card Transactions, Purchasing
  • Log and process office P-card and T-card transactions.
  • Maintain office equipment records and monitor office supply inventory.
  • Order supplies through I-Buy and submit purchase orders for Access Point units.
Seasonal Projects & Special Events
  • Provide administrative support for various projects and events requested by Access Point units.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by supervisor.
Minimum Qualifications

1. High school diploma or equivalent.

2. Any one or combination totaling two (2) years (24 months) from the categories below:

A. College coursework in any curriculum, as measured by the following conversion table or its proportional equivalent:
  • 30 semester hours equals one (1) year (12 months)
  • Associate's Degree (60 semester hours) equals eighteen months (18 months)
  • 90 semester hours equals two (2) years (24 months)
  • Bachelor's Degree (120 semester hours) equals three (3) years (36 months)
B. Work experience performing office/clerical activities, including the use of computer systems.

3. One (1) year (12 months) of work experience comparable to the second level of this series.

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ities:
  • Exceptional customer service skills, using training and team resources to accurately answer questions, solve problems and meet needs.
  • Professional, courteous, and hospitable attitude, including in busy and stressful situations.
  • Ability to accurately complete tasks and responsibilities in a timely manner without constant supervision.
  • Ability to follow instructions and receive and implement constructive feedback.
  • Ability to prioritize and execute multiple tasks, duties, responsibilities, and deadlines, according to goals set by supervisor.
  • Ability to anticipate needs and proactively plan or seek out productive work during "downtime."
  • Strong written and verbal communication, including documenting processes and procedures.
Appointment Information

This is a 100% full-time Civil Service 3243 - Office Support Specialist position, appointed on a 12-month basis. The expected start date is as soon as possible after the close date. This is a bargained position and as such, the salary is driven by the collective bargaining agreement. The entry-level salary for the Office Support Specialist classification is $40,400 ($20.718/hour). Employees hired into this position will be expected to work on-site full-time.
